Masked Singer faces show shake-up as three celebrities set to join judging panel

The Masked Singer is set to undergo a major shake-up as three new celebrities are set to join the judging panel, according to The Sun.

The star-studded panel is made up of Jonathan Ross, Rita Ora, Davina McCall and Mo Gilligan and the team will sit beside a few familiar faces for a one-off special.

Former England striker Peter Crouch is returning to familiar territory following his impressive stint on the second series of The Masked Dancer in 2022.

Catchphrase presenter Stephen Mulhern and comedian Lee Mack will also join the 42-year-old alongside the four regular judges.

This Saturday marks the quarter-finals and seven celebrities will be cut down to just five in a brutal double elimination.

The remaining celebrities battling it out include Fawn, Jacket Potato, Rhino, Jellyfish, Knitting, Otter and Phoenix.

Following a tense sing-off with Jacket Potato, comedian Katherine Ryan left the judges stunned when she was unveiled as Pigeon.

After the big reveal, Katherine told viewers: "I love Pigeon because she's a sassy nana. An East End bird. A real grafter. And crucially, a fan of hip hop who can bust a move.

"The Masked Singer is one of the very few shows that we can all thoroughly enjoy as a family.

"I love theatre and thought that even though I'm not a professional singer, I could have some fun and sell it on personality while surprising my children with the reveal".

The Canadian star went on to address the judges incorrect guesses, adding: "I was flattered the panel thought I might actually be from Essex like Gemma Collins or Stacey Solomon.

"They even guessed Maya Jama which – to be honest – I'm mistaken for often even without a mask. We are very similar, both stunning and talented."

The reveal came as a particular shock as the show was filmed when Katherine was just one month away from giving birth to her baby girl.

Katherine welcomed Fenna in December – her second child with partner Bobby Kootstra.
